emg findings

by Sparklytami, Mar 19, 2007 12:00AM
EMG findings, 1. minimal right tibial dermopathy of unknown etiology  2. there is no evidence to suggest or polyneuropathi process 3. needle emg findings are most compatible with a myopathy, I do have low vitamin d levels, have tried mega dose vit d 50,000 units a week for 6 weeks, but levels only go up for a couple of weeks and then back down.  I have muscle pain, profound weakness, fatigue easily , some bone pain, joint pain.  i have proximal and distal involvement.  short duration motor units, decreased recruitment in both upper and lower extremities.  GI follow-up, IBS with probable malabsorption.  Endocrinologist or Neurologist will not prescribe the mega dose vit d to get it up because ionized calcium is 5.9.  I did see Dr at Mayo Clinic, muscle biopsy showed type 2 atrophy, I don't know what else to do, now one locally has a patient like this, i wondered if i have something other than vit d myopathy, i have freqent fasciculations.  i didn't know what the tibial dermopathy meant other than skin disease??  I don't know who to turn to
